Éringes
Éringes is a village in Éringes, Arrondissement of Montbard, Bourgogne-Franche-Comté and has about 57 residents. Éringes is situated nearby to the village Fresnes, as well as near Seigny.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Village with 57 residents
- Also known as: “Eringes”
- Postal codes: 21500 and 21500
